About This School

Akin Elementary School is a elementary school located in Greenville, Mississippi. The school serves 352 students in grades 1-5. The student-to-teacher ratio is 17.6:1.

According to EDFacts assessment data, 29% of students meet grade-level proficiency standards in combined math and reading.

100% of students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, indicating the school serves a predominantly low-income community.

Akin Elementary School is part of the Greenville Public Schools in Mississippi. The school receives Title I federal funding.

How This School Compares

Akin Elementary School has 352 students enrolled, making it larger than the average school in Greenville Public Schools (322 students). Its 29% proficiency rate is 2 percentage points above the district average of 27%. Compared to the Mississippi state average of 30%, the school performs 1 points lower.
